How they compare
Saint Barthélemy currently reports 40.0% against 38.6% in Greece, a difference of 1.4%.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Saint Barthélemy ahead.
Greece ranks 168th and Saint Barthélemy ranks 167th of 247 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Greece averaged higher in 2 and Saint Barthélemy in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Greece | Saint Barthélemy |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 12.0% | 8.1% | 3.9% | Greece |
| 2010s | 21.0% | 14.5% | 6.5% | Greece |
| 2020s | 32.4% | 35.4% | 3.0% | Saint Barthélemy |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
